Birthright Armenia

Birthright Armenia, also known as the Armenian name Hayk Depi (Armenian Դեպի Հայք ), is a voluntary program for development cooperation in Armenia. Participants may be financially supported by a scholarship abroad.

History

Birthright Armenia was founded in 2003 as an international non-profit organization. The aim of this organization is a deeper bond of diaspora Armenians to Armenia by them is given the ability to participate in everyday life in Armenia.

Applications are open to people of Armenian descent aged 20-32 years. The duration for Voluntary Service can be between two months.

In 2011, more than 500 volunteers from 25 countries at the Birthright Armenia Program.

Similar organizations

Organizations with similar objectives are, inter alia, Birthright Israel, which allow educational and cultural exchange programs in connection with Jewish history and culture. The organization IrishWay organizes trips for Irish-American high school students to Ireland. Another similar project is Birthright Greece, which targets the Greek diaspora.
